Mannford Public Library

Search Mannford Oklahoma

Mannford Public Library, serving an area of 2,100 residents, has a collection of 14,700 books and periodicals; in addition, there are 189 CDs, records, cassettes and other audio materials, as well as 840 video items, such as DVDs and VHS tapes. Internet terminals are available for use by the general public.

Staffing consists of 3 employees, including one fully accredited librarian, plus volunteers. Annual expenditures on the library collection total $8,400. Patrons make 11,000 visits annually, and check out materials 22,000 times. Fifty percent of all check-outs are children's materials.
